Abstract:
Objective To investigate the sleep quality and related influencing factors in pediatric ICU nurses.Methods The study investigated 332 pediatric ICU nurses from six level three hospitals in Hubei province in April 201 5.The sleep status of the participants were assessed by Pittsburgh sleep quality index (PSQI)rating scale.Results The pooled score was (7.73 ±1 .54)and the scores of all the seven dimensions were higher than the Chinese norm (P <0.05).The PSQI scores of 1 92 participants were no less than eight points,which indicated an existing of sleep disorders.The differences of the sores between different professional title,marriage status,work shift,education,working age,and working environment had statistical significant (P <0.05).Conclusions The sleep quality of pediatric ICU nursing staffs was significantly worse than the general population,especially for co-chiefnurse.Factors including divorce,work shifts,college degree,working age >1 0 years,ward noise >60 dB and illumination >1 00 LUX can worse the situation.
